Product Specs:
- Primary Display: Foldable 6.9" 2640x1080 165Hz LTPO AMOLED
- External Secondary Display (when folded): 4" 1272x1080 165Hz LTPO AMOLED (Gorilla Glass Victus)
- Qualcomm Snapdragon 8s Gen 3 Octa-core Processor
- 256GB internal storage
- 12GB RAM
- Main Cameras: 50 MP (wide) / 50 MP (telephoto)
- Selfie Camera: 32 MP (wide)
- WiFi 7 / Bluetooth 5.4 / NFC
- Fingerprint sensor (side-mounted)
- USB 2.0 Type-C port w/ 45W fast charging & 5W reverse wired charging
- 15W wireless charging
- 4000 mAh battery
- Android 15
- 1-Year Motorola Manufacturer Limited Warranty
- Note: No 3.5mm headphone jack, no microSD card slot
- Universal unlocked: Compatible with all major U.S. carriers, including Verizon, AT&T, T-Mobile and other prepaid carriers.
